1、案例一:
答案:
package com.itheima;
public class ExerciseDemo1 {
public static void main(String[] args) {
skipNumber7();
}
public static void skipNumber7(){
for (int i = 1; i <= 100; i++) {
if(judge(i)){
System.out.print("过" + " ");
}else {
System.out.print(i + " ");
}
}
}
public static boolean judge(int num){
// 7的倍数
if(num % 7 == 0){
return true;
}
//包含7
while (num != 0) {
if (num % 10 == 7) {
return true;
}
num = num / 10;
}
return false;
}
}
2、案例二:
答案:
package com.itheima;
public class ExerciseDemo2 {
public static void main(String[] args) {
int[] arr = {
68,27,95,88,171,996,51,210};
int sum = getSum(arr);
System.out.println("总和为:" + sum);
}
public static int getSum(int[] arr){
int sum = 0;
for (int i = 0; i < arr.length; i++) {
int ge = arr[i] % 10;
int shi = arr[i] / 10 % 10;
if (ge != 7 && shi !